Nestled in the heart of Ozaukee County, Saukville, Wisconsin, offers a charming blend of small-town appeal and modern conveniences, making it an attractive destination for residents and visitors alike. With an estimated population of around 4,500, this quaint village is known for its friendly community atmosphere and scenic surroundings. Saukville is ideally situated just a short drive from the bustling city of Milwaukee, providing easy access to urban amenities while maintaining its peaceful, rural character.

Saukville is home to several local attractions that appeal to tourists and residents, including the Riveredge Nature Center, a sprawling natural area perfect for hiking, bird watching, and enjoying the beauty of Wisconsin's diverse ecosystems. The nearby Milwaukee River offers opportunities for fishing and kayaking, making it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. The village's vibrant community events, such as the annual Saukville Scare 5K Run/Walk and the popular Live at the Triangle summer concert series, foster a strong sense of community and provide entertainment for all ages.

For seniors, Saukville presents a welcoming environment with its low crime rates, accessible healthcare facilities, and a variety of recreational activities tailored to their interests. The village's commitment to maintaining a high quality of life for its residents is evident in its well-maintained parks and community services.

Assisted Living Costs in Saukville, Wisconsin

When considering assisted living options in Saukville, Wisconsin, understanding the financial landscape is crucial for making informed decisions. Saukville offers a more affordable alternative compared to the state's median, with the average monthly cost of assisted living being approximately $4,419. This is notably lower than Wisconsin's overall median of $5,500, as reported by Genworth's Cost of Care Study. This cost variation can provide significant financial relief for families seeking quality care for their loved ones without compromising on the standard of living.

Proximity to quality healthcare facilities is an important factor for many families. Saukville residents benefit from nearby hospitals such as Aurora Medical Center in Grafton and Columbia St. Mary's Ozaukee Hospital in Mequon. These facilities ensure that residents have access to top-notch medical care when needed, enhancing the appeal of Saukville as a location for assisted living.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Saukville, Wisconsin

Navigating the world of senior care can be challenging, especially with the variety of options available in Saukville, Wisconsin. Understanding the differences between assisted living, memory care, nursing homes, and independent living is crucial for making the right choice for yourself or a loved one.

Assisted living facilities offer a blend of independence and support, providing personal care services, meals, and social activities. These communities are ideal for seniors who need some assistance with daily activities but do not require constant medical care. Residents enjoy private or semi-private apartments and access to communal spaces, fostering a sense of community.

Memory care units are specialized facilities within assisted living or standalone centers designed for individuals with Alzheimer's or other forms of dementia. These facilities provide 24-hour supervised care, structured activities, and specialized staff trained to handle the unique challenges associated with memory loss. Safety features are also a priority to prevent wandering and ensure residents' well-being.

Nursing homes, or skilled nursing facilities, offer the highest level of care outside a hospital. They provide round-the-clock medical care and assistance with daily activities for individuals with significant health needs or chronic conditions. Nursing homes have licensed medical professionals on staff, making them suitable for those requiring intensive rehabilitation or long-term care.

Independent living communities cater to seniors who are self-sufficient but prefer a lifestyle without the burdens of home maintenance. These communities offer amenities like housekeeping, transportation, and social activities, promoting an active and engaged lifestyle.

Choosing the right facility in Saukville depends on the individual's health needs, lifestyle preferences, and financial considerations. It's essential to visit potential communities, assess the services offered, and consult with healthcare professionals to ensure the best fit for a fulfilling and supportive living environment.

How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Saukville, Wisconsin

Qualifying for assisted living in Saukville, Wisconsin, involves meeting certain criteria that ensure the facility can adequately address your needs. Here’s a guide to help you understand the process and requirements:

1. Assessment of Needs: The first step is to undergo a comprehensive assessment by a healthcare professional. This evaluation helps determine the level of care required, including daily living assistance, medical supervision, and personal care needs. Facilities in Saukville typically conduct their own assessments to ensure they can meet your specific needs.

2. Financial Evaluation: Assisted living can be costly, so a financial assessment is crucial. Residents or their families should evaluate their financial situation to understand how they will cover the costs. In Wisconsin, the average monthly cost of assisted living is around $4,000, though this can vary based on the facility and level of care required.

3. Medicaid and Government Programs: For those needing financial assistance, Wisconsin’s Medicaid program, known as Family Care, can help cover some costs associated with assisted living. This program supports elderly and disabled individuals by providing funding for long-term care services. Eligibility is based on income and asset limits, so it's essential to verify your qualification with the local Medicaid office.

4. Legal and Medical Documentation: Prepare necessary legal and medical documents, such as power of attorney, living wills, and medical records. These documents facilitate a smoother transition and ensure that the facility can provide appropriate care.

5. Residency Requirements: Some facilities may have residency requirements, such as living in Wisconsin for a certain period. It's advisable to check with individual facilities for specific criteria.

For those considering assisted living in Saukville, thorough preparation and understanding of these requirements can significantly ease the transition into a supportive and caring environment.

Advantages and Disadvantages: Assisted Living in Saukville, Wisconsin

Assisted living facilities provide a supportive environment for seniors who need help with daily activities but wish to maintain a level of independence. Saukville, Wisconsin, offers several options for assisted living, each with its unique advantages and disadvantages.

One of the primary advantages of assisted living in Saukville is the community's small-town charm combined with access to essential services and amenities. Residents can enjoy a peaceful lifestyle while being close to nature, with parks and recreational areas nearby. The local community is known for its friendly atmosphere, which can be comforting for seniors and their families. Additionally, the cost of living in Saukville is generally lower than in larger cities, making assisted living more affordable.

Facilities in Saukville often provide a range of care options tailored to individual needs, from basic assistance with daily activities to more comprehensive care plans. This flexibility allows residents to receive the appropriate level of support while maintaining as much independence as possible. Moreover, the smaller size of many facilities in Saukville can foster a more personalized approach to care, where staff members have the opportunity to build strong relationships with residents.

However, there are also disadvantages to consider. The limited number of facilities in a smaller town like Saukville may mean fewer choices for residents and their families. Additionally, specialized medical services might not be as readily available locally, potentially requiring travel to nearby cities for certain healthcare needs. This could be challenging for families who want immediate access to a wide range of medical specialists.

Overall, assisted living in Saukville, Wisconsin, offers a balanced blend of community, affordability, and personalized care, though it may require some trade-offs in terms of choice and access to specialized services.
